The father of Hamburg striker Jann-Fiete Arp has raised the prospect of his son leaving the German club if they are relegated from the Bundesliga this season.

The 18 year old was subject to an offer from Chelsea in the summer before he signed a contract extension with his current team, but speaking with German website Sportbuzzer, Falke Arp questioned whether it would be a good idea to remain at Hamburg if they are playing in the second division:

“If the HSV should descend, you have to ask yourself if it makes sense to go to the second league.”

Hamburg are currently second from bottom in the Bundesliga. They are only two points from safety but the German side have struggled for the past five years, finishing just above the relegation zone on a regular basis.

Arp has however been given his first team debut by the club this season, having scored two goals in his first three league games. He has so far made nine senior appearances in all competitions, making six starts.
